# Pastebin AMkNmrL0 02: lib: rational: Move the Kconfigs into the correct place aarch64: x240 turris_mox mvebu_ac5_rd eDPU mvebu_db-88f3720 mvebu_espressobin-88f3720 uDPU clearfog_gt_8k mvebu_db_armada8k mvebu_mcbin-88f8040 mvebu_puzzle-m801-88f8040 mvebu_crb_cn9130 mvebu_db_cn9130 arm: ge_b1x5v2 smdkc100 stv0991 imxrt1020-evk imxrt1050-evk imxrt1170-evk 03: Kconfig: Move API into general setup 04: video: Move bmp code to drivers/video arm: (for 655/655 boards) all +0.0 text +0.0 imx6q_icore_nand: all +12 text +12 imx6qdl_icore_nand: all +12 text +12 mx6sabreauto : all +8 text +8 aristainetos2c : all +6 text +6 aristainetos2ccslb: all +6 text +6 m53menlo : all +4 text +4 pico-dwarf-imx7d: all +4 text +4 pico-nymph-imx7d: all +4 text +4 pico-pi-imx7d : all +4 text +4 imx6qdl_icore_mmc: all -8 text -8 am335x_guardian: all -10 text -10 ge_bx50v3 : all -10 text -10 sandbox: (for 6/7 boards) all +78.7 rodata -10.7 text +89.3 sandbox_flattree: all +632 rodata +96 text +536 u-boot: add: 3/0, grow: 0/0 bytes: 394/0 (394) function old new delta bmp_display - 211 +211 bmp_info - 176 +176 gunzip_bmp - 7 +7 sandbox : all -32 rodata -32 sandbox64 : all -32 rodata -32 sandbox_noinst : all -32 rodata -32 sandbox_spl : all -32 rodata -32 sandbox_vpl : all -32 rodata -32 x86: (for 29/29 boards) all +60.3 text +60.3 efi-x86_app64 : all +1202 text +1202 u-boot: add: 3/0, grow: 3/0 bytes: 515/0 (515) function old new delta phy_interface_strings 22528 22784 +256 bmp_display - 139 +139 bmp_info - 100 +100 backplane_mode_strings 1408 1424 +16 gunzip_bmp - 3 +3 error_message 225 226 +1 efi-x86_app32 : all +547 text +547 u-boot: add: 3/0, grow: 3/0 bytes: 412/0 (412) function old new delta bmp_display - 150 +150 phy_interface_strings 11392 11520 +128 bmp_info - 122 +122 backplane_mode_strings 712 720 +8 gunzip_bmp - 3 +3 error_message 224 225 +1 05: video: Move the BMP options aarch64: (for 426/426 boards) all -0.0 rodata -0.0 uniphier_v8 : all -4 rodata -4 arm: (for 655/655 boards) all -0.0 rodata -0.0 stemmy : all -1 rodata -1 opos6uldev : all -2 rodata -2 uniphier_ld4_sld8: all -4 rodata -4 uniphier_v7 : all -4 rodata -4 sama5d2_icp_qspiflash: all -5 rodata -5 sandbox: (for 6/7 boards) all +16.0 rodata +16.0 sandbox_noinst : all +32 rodata +32 sandbox_spl : all +32 rodata +32 sandbox_vpl : all +32 rodata +32 06: video: Move BMP options and code to video directory arm: (for 655/655 boards) all -0.0 rodata +0.0 text -0.0 opos6uldev : all +3 rodata +3 stemmy : all -1 rodata -1 pico-dwarf-imx7d: all -4 text -4 pico-nymph-imx7d: all -4 text -4 pico-pi-imx7d : all -4 text -4 sandbox: (for 6/7 boards) all +26.7 rodata +26.7 sandbox : all +32 rodata +32 sandbox64 : all +32 rodata +32 sandbox_noinst : all +32 rodata +32 sandbox_spl : all +32 rodata +32 sandbox_vpl : all +32 rodata +32 07: FWU: Avoid showing an unselectable menu option aarch64: (for 426/426 boards) all -0.0 rodata -0.0 uniphier_v8 : all -19 rodata -19 arm: (for 655/655 boards) all -0.1 rodata -0.1 stemmy : all -16 rodata -16 uniphier_ld4_sld8: all -18 rodata -18 sama5d2_icp_qspiflash: all -18 rodata -18 opos6uldev : all -18 rodata -18 uniphier_v7 : all -20 rodata -20 riscv64: (for 16/16 boards) all -1.5 rodata -1.5 th1520_lpi4a : all -24 rodata -24 sandbox: (for 6/7 boards) all -21.3 rodata -21.3 sandbox_flattree: all -32 rodata -32 sandbox_noinst : all -32 rodata -32 sandbox_spl : all -32 rodata -32 sandbox_vpl : all -32 rodata -32 08: test: Move POST under a renamed Testing section aarch64: (for 426/426 boards) all -0.0 rodata -0.0 uniphier_v8 : all -4 rodata -4 arm: (for 655/655 boards) all -0.0 rodata -0.0 sama5d2_icp_qspiflash: all -2 rodata -2 stemmy : all -2 rodata -2 uniphier_v7 : all -3 rodata -3 opos6uldev : all -3 rodata -3 uniphier_ld4_sld8: all -4 rodata -4 09: boot: Move fdt_support to boot/ arm: (for 655/655 boards) all -0.1 spl/u-boot-spl:all +0.0 spl/u-boot-spl:text +0.0 text -0.1 draco : all +10 text +10 rastaban : all +10 text +10 thuban : all +10 text +10 Ainol_AW1 : all +10 text +10 Wexler_TAB7200 : all +10 text +10 pcm051_rev3 : all +4 text +4 am335x_hs_evm_uart: all +4 text +4 k2g_hs_evm : all +4 text +4 imx6ulz_smm_m2 : all +4 text +4 imx6qdl_icore_mipi: spl/u-boot-spl:all +4 spl/u-boot-spl:text +4 imx6qdl_icore_mmc: spl/u-boot-spl:all +4 spl/u-boot-spl:text +4 imx6qdl_icore_rqs: spl/u-boot-spl:all +4 spl/u-boot-spl:text +4 gwventana_emmc : all +4 text +4 imx6q_logic : all +4 text +4 igep00x0 : all +4 text +4 socfpga_sr1500 : all +4 text +4 A20-OLinuXino-Lime2: all +4 text +4 bananapi_m2_berry: all +4 text +4 colorfly_e708_q1: all +4 text +4 inet_q972 : all +4 text +4 MSI_Primo81 : all +4 text +4 Yones_Toptech_BS1078_V2: all +4 text +4 zeropi : all +4 text +4 grpeach : all +2 text +2 brppt1_mmc : all -4 text -4 brsmarc1 : all -4 text -4 brxre1 : all -4 text -4 am335x_pdu001 : all -4 text -4 am335x_evm_spiboot: spl/u-boot-spl:all -4 spl/u-boot-spl:text -4 am43xx_evm_usbhost_boot: all -4 text -4 snow : all -4 text -4 k2hk_evm : all -4 text -4 mt7629_rfb : all -4 text -4 imx6q_bosch_acc: all -4 text -4 brppt2 : all -4 text -4 ge_bx50v3 : all -4 text -4 am57xx_hs_evm_usb: all -4 text -4 rzn1_snarc : all -4 text -4 Bananapi_m2m : all -4 text -4 beelink_x2 : all -4 text -4 libretech_all_h3_cc_h2_plus: all -4 text -4 libretech_all_h3_cc_h3: all -4 text -4 Orangepi : all -4 text -4 orangepi_zero_plus2_h3: all -4 text -4 bk4r1 : all -4 text -4 colibri_vf : all -4 text -4 stm32f429-evaluation: all -4 text -4 stm32f469-discovery: all -4 text -4 stm32h743-disco: all -4 text -4 stm32h743-eval : all -4 text -4 stm32h750-art-pi: all -4 text -4 phycore-am335x-r2-regor: all -8 text -8 phycore-am335x-r2-wega: all -8 text -8 opos6uldev : all -8 text -8 stemmy : all -8 text -8 pcm052 : all -8 text -8 aristainetos2c : all -10 text -10 aristainetos2ccslb: all -10 text -10 wandboard : all -10 text -10 somlabs_visionsom_6ull: all -10 text -10 stm32mp15_dhcor_basic: all -10 text -10 riscv32: (for 7/7 boards) spl/u-boot-spl:all +1.7 spl/u-boot-spl:text +1.7 ae350_rv32_spl : spl/u-boot-spl:all +6 spl/u-boot-spl:text +6 spl-u-boot-spl: add: 0/0, grow: 2/0 bytes: 6/0 (6) function old new delta spl_load_simple_fit 678 682 +4 spl_load_fit_image 362 364 +2 ae350_rv32_spl_xip: spl/u-boot-spl:all +4 spl/u-boot-spl:text +4 spl-u-boot-spl: add: 0/0, grow: 2/-2 bytes: 6/-4 (2) function old new delta spl_load_simple_fit 678 682 +4 spl_load_fit_image 362 364 +2 static.device_of_to_plat 200 198 -2 device_of_to_plat 200 198 -2 qemu-riscv32_spl: spl/u-boot-spl:all +2 spl/u-boot-spl:text +2 spl-u-boot-spl: add: 0/0, grow: 1/-1 bytes: 4/-2 (2) function old new delta spl_load_simple_fit 678 682 +4 fdt_subnode_offset_namelen 156 154 -2 sandbox: (for 6/7 boards) all +21.3 data +26.7 rodata -5.3 sandbox_flattree: all +32 data +32 sandbox_noinst : all +32 data +32 sandbox_spl : all +32 data +32 sandbox_vpl : all +32 data +32 sandbox : data +32 rodata -32 10: Move fdt_simplefb to boot/ aarch64: (for 426/426 boards) all +0.0 rodata +0.0 uniphier_v8 : all +14 rodata +14 arm: (for 655/655 boards) all +0.1 rodata +0.1 sama5d2_icp_qspiflash: all +13 rodata +13 stemmy : all +13 rodata +13 uniphier_v7 : all +12 rodata +12 opos6uldev : all +12 rodata +12 uniphier_ld4_sld8: all +11 rodata +11 riscv64: (for 16/16 boards) all +1.0 rodata +1.0 th1520_lpi4a : all +16 rodata +16 sandbox: (for 6/7 boards) all +5.3 rodata +5.3 sandbox_flattree: all +32 rodata +32 11: boot: Move some other fdt-fixup options to the same menu aarch64: (for 426/426 boards) all -0.0 rodata -0.0 uniphier_v8 : all -3 rodata -3 arm: (for 655/655 boards) all +0.0 rodata +0.0 uniphier_ld4_sld8: all +2 rodata +2 sama5d2_icp_qspiflash: all +2 rodata +2 uniphier_v7 : all +1 rodata +1 stemmy : all +1 rodata +1 riscv64: (for 16/16 boards) all -0.5 rodata -0.5 th1520_lpi4a : all -8 rodata -8 12: boot: Rename Android-boot text 13: Kconfig: Create a menu for FIT 14: spl: Tidy up load address in spl_ram 15: spl: Drop SPL/TPL_RAM_SUPPORT option for SPL_LOAD_FIT_ADDRESS aarch64: - u-boot.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- u-boot-spl.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- all: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 arm: - u-boot.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- u-boot-spl.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- all: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 microblaze: - u-boot.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- u-boot-spl.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- all: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 alt apalis-tk1 apalis_t30 beaver bitmain_antminer_s9 cardhu cei-tk1-som colibri_t20 colibri_t30 dalmore endeavoru gose grouper_common harmony jetson-tk1 koelsch lager medcom-wide microblaze-generic nyan-big paz00 plutux porter sama5d2_icp_mmc seaboard silk socfpga_agilex socfpga_arria10 socfpga_arria5 socfpga_chameleonv3 socfpga_cyclone5 socfpga_dbm_soc1 socfpga_de0_nano_soc socfpga_de10_nano socfpga_de10_standard socfpga_de1_soc socfpga_is1 socfpga_mcvevk socfpga_n5x socfpga_secu1 socfpga_sockit socfpga_socrates socfpga_sr1500 socfpga_stratix10 socfpga_vining_fpga stout syzygy_hub tec tec-ng topic_miami topic_miamilite topic_miamiplus transformer_t30 trimslice venice2 ventana x3_t30 zynq_cse_nand zynq_cse_nor zynq_cse_qspi : - u-boot.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- u-boot-spl.cfg: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 - all: CONFIG_SPL_LOAD_FIT_ADDRESS=0x0 16: Kconfig: Move SPL_FIT under FIT 17: boot: Make standard boot a menu 18: Kconfig: Move TEXT_BASE et al under general setup aarch64: (for 426/426 boards) all +0.0 rodata +0.0 uniphier_v8 : all +4 rodata +4 arm: (for 655/655 boards) all +0.0 rodata +0.0 opos6uldev : all +5 rodata +5 uniphier_ld4_sld8: all +4 rodata +4 uniphier_v7 : all +4 rodata +4 sama5d2_icp_qspiflash: all +3 rodata +3 stemmy : all +3 rodata +3 riscv64: (for 16/16 boards) all +0.5 rodata +0.5 th1520_lpi4a : all +8 rodata +8 19: Mark DISTRO_DEFAULTS as deprecated 20: Make ARCH_FIXUP_FDT_MEMORY depend on OF_LIBFDT arm: - u-boot.cfg: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 - u-boot-spl.cfg: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 - all: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 work_92105 : - u-boot.cfg: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 - u-boot-spl.cfg: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 - all: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 nokia_rx51 : - u-boot.cfg: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 - all: CONFIG_ARCH_FIXUP_FDT_MEMORY=1 21: boot: Join FDT_FIXUP_PARTITIONS with related options aarch64: (for 426/426 boards) all +0.0 rodata +0.0 uniphier_v8 : all +2 rodata +2 arm: (for 655/655 boards) all +0.0 rodata +0.0 uniphier_ld4_sld8: all +1 rodata +1 22: boot: Drop CMD_MTDPARTS condition for FDT_FIXUP_PARTITIONS arm: (for 655/655 boards) all +0.0 rodata +0.0 stemmy : all +7 rodata +7 sama5d2_icp_qspiflash: all +6 rodata +6 opos6uldev : all +6 rodata +6 sandbox: (for 6/7 boards) all +16.0 rodata +16.0 sandbox_noinst : all +32 rodata +32 sandbox_spl : all +32 rodata +32 sandbox_vpl : all +32 rodata +32 23: boot: Join ARCH_FIXUP_FDT_MEMORY with related options aarch64: (for 426/426 boards) all -0.0 rodata -0.0 uniphier_v8 : all -1 rodata -1 arm: (for 655/655 boards) all -0.0 rodata -0.0 sama5d2_icp_qspiflash: all +2 rodata +2 uniphier_ld4_sld8: all -2 rodata -2 uniphier_v7 : all -2 rodata -2 stemmy : all -2 rodata -2 opos6uldev : all -3 rodata -3 sandbox: (for 6/7 boards) all -5.3 rodata -5.3 sandbox_noinst : all -32 rodata -32 24: buildman: Fix full help for Python 3.8